The first stumbling block has been hit, but thanks to Kleemann and House of Cars it's an "easy fix".

Unfortunately my E55 is running the older 2.0 ECU and not the 2.8, it also doesn't have an OBD-II port, it has the 38 pin data port under the bonnet.

Long story short, it's a more complicated process remapping the my spec ECU, which includes the replacement of chips on the it's board etc.

That being said, Claus at Kleemann advised us to ship the ECU to him in Denmark, which House of Cars have done via TNT's express service, so the ECU's board, chipset, and programs can all be modified.

The ECU will be shipped back express by Kleemann, so we should have it back before the kits is fully plumbed in.

Sorry to hear that bro., never mind, Claus can handle that easily,,

i think you mean 38pin in fuse box isn't, just U.S version got 16pin under steering..

*Japan/Gulf spec.:-

W210 Mercedes E55 AMG Project-w210-fuse-port.jpg

*U.S spec.:-

W210 Mercedes E55 AMG Project-w210-steering-port.jpg

I will see if the numbers were noted when I get to the garage again tomorrow. When I made my comment about knowing how the stock headers perform, I meant that in the way of getting under the car and actually studying the pipework, which I have done.

Not only are the stock header pipes encased within the "large" outer shield restrictive, there are bends and kinks in the stock system which create a huge restriction compared to upgraded systems.

Again I will say really study the W210 stock system, not just assume to understand "the purpose of headers", as If you really understand the stock units you would know exactly why it's pretty much essential to swap them out.
